This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for the South Plains, Rolling
Plains, and the far Southern Texas Panhandle.

.DAY ONE...Today and tonight.

There is a low probability for widespread hazardous weather.

.D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Monday through Saturday.

Temperatures or heat index values near 105 degrees will be possible
across the far southeastern Texas Panhandle and portions of the
Rolling Plains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day afternoons.

Low chances for late-afternoon and evening thunderstorms remain in
the forecast for portions of the far southern Texas Panhandle, South
Plains, and Rolling Plains from Tuesday through Saturday.

.S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T...

Spotter activation is not expected at this time.
